PHP下载远程文件到指定目录

PHP 162浏览 2评论
PHP用curl可以轻松实现下载远程文件到指定目录:
/**
 * @param $url string 远程文件链接,如:http://www.awaimai.com/uploads/origin.zip
 * @param $local string 本地文件路径,如:/mnt/www/download/test.zip
 * @return mixed 头信息
 */
function curlDownload($url, $local)
{
    $ch = curl_init($url);
    $fp = fopen($local, "wb");
    curl_setopt($ch, CURLOPT_FILE, $fp);
    curl_setopt($ch, CURLOPT_HEADER, 0);
    $res = curl_exec($ch);
    curl_close($ch);
    fclose($fp);

    return $res;
}
发表我的评论
取消评论

表情

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

网友最新评论 (2)

  1. 写的不错啊
    ShunYea 2个月前 (04-17) 回复 编辑
  2. fs
    ta 2个月前 (04-19) 回复 编辑